This epidemic -- a result of the toxins in our diet; exposure to chemicals, heavy metals, and antibiotics; and unprecedented stress levels -- has caused millions to suffer from autoimmune conditions such as Graves’ disease, rheumatoid arthritis, Crohn’s disease, celiac disease, lupus, and more. Dr. Susan Blum, author of The Immune System Recovery Plan, shares the four-step program she used to treat her own serious autoimmune condition and help countless patients reverse their symptoms, heal their immune systems, and prevent future illness. Part of the process includes: Using food as medicine Understanding the stress connection Healing your gut and digestive system Optimizing liver function Listen as Dr. Blum joins Dr. Taz to explain the importance of the microbiome, as well as how you can balance your immune system, transform your health, and live a fuller, happier life.
